Automobile Upholstery Market Overview
Global Automobile Upholstery Market size is projected at USD 146900.89 million in 2026 and is expected to hit USD 229852.12 million by 2035 with a CAGR of 5.1%.

Top Two Companies with Highest Market Share
- Lear holds approximately 19% market share supported by large-scale seating and interior systems integration across more than 40 global OEM platforms.
- Adient accounts for nearly 16% market share driven by strong seat manufacturing capabilities and supply relationships with over 30 major automotive brands worldwide.
